#!/bin/bash # Name and description name="mixer-osd" description="Provides an OSD (On Screen Display) for basic mixer operations." # Some variables default_color="green" acolor=$default_color # This program depends on aosd_cat and amixer (alsa-utils in Debian) deps="aosd_cat amixer" function usage() { show_name=$1 error=$2 # Show name and description only if explicitly stated if [[ $show_name == 1 ]] ; then echo -e " $name - $description\n" fi # Show an error message, if present if [[ $error != '' ]] ; then echo -e "\033[1m$error\033[0m\n" fi cat << EOF Usage: $name -u|-d|-m $name -h Options: -u Volume up -d Volume down -m Mute/Unmute -h Shows this help. EOF } # Check for dependencies for dep in $deps ; do if [[ `which $dep` == '' ]] ; then echo "Please, install $dep for $name to work!" exit 1 fi done # Managing options while getopts "hudm" option ; do case $option in h ) usage 1 exit 0 ;; u ) aarg="Volume ↑ $(amixer -c 0 sset Master 2+ unmute | tail -1 | awk '{print $4}' | tr -d '[]')" acolor="royalblue" ;; d ) aarg="Volume ↓ $(amixer -c 0 sset Master 2- unmute | tail -1 | awk '{print $4}' | tr -d '[]')" acolor="gray50" ;; m ) case $(amixer -c 0 sset Master toggle | tail -1 | awk '{print $6}' | tr -d '[]') in on ) aarg="UNMUTED" acolor="green" ;; off ) aarg="MUTED" acolor="red" ;; esac ;; \? ) echo -e "Please type ${name} -h for help on usage." exit 1 ;; esac done shift $(($OPTIND - 1)) # This program doesn't accept any other argument than flag-options if [[ $# -gt 0 ]] ; then usage 0 "Invalid argument (\`$1')." exit 1 fi # One have to either mute/unmute or change the volume, # otherwise program will exit with error code 1 if [[ -z $aarg ]] ; then usage 0 "Please, mute/unmute or change the volume!" exit 1 fi # Kills any instance of aosd_cat pkill aosd_cat >/dev/null 2>&1 # Performs osd-ized volume changes echo "$aarg" | aosd_cat \ --fore-color=$acolor \ --position 4 \ --font="Droid Sans Bold 32" \ --y-offset=300 \ --transparency=2 \ --back-color="gray10" \ --back-opacity=50 \ --padding=20 \ --fade-full=1500 >/dev/null 2>&1 & exit $?
